Trump says DC triumphal arch will become military complex
President Trump announced on Sunday that plans for a Washington DC triumphal arch will convert the structure into a top grade military complex.

Military storage and sniper facilities
Trump stated the US military requested this change for national security purposes. The project would include drone and ammunition storage space along with customised sniper facilities on the roof and plaza. He claimed the structure could house and store large quantities of sniper ammunition.
Criticism over historic impact
The proposed location near the Memorial Bridge could interrupt sight lines to the Lincoln Memorial and Arlington National Cemetery. The National Park Service warned that construction might have adverse effects on historic properties in downtown Washington DC. Democratic Congress members also raised questions regarding the site close to Ronald Reagan Washington international airport.
